Abstract
The objective of this article is to analyze the collaborative mechanisms reported by the socioproductive actors of Usiacurí-Atlantic for the development of sustainable alternative tourism in times of pandemic. The methodology corresponds to an analytical research with the model of structural analysis of relationships in networks with support of adjacency matrix. Even though the relationships with various actors in the network are moderate, they are mostly circumstantial, showing that there are various mechanisms of collaboration that can be used in a new tourism model that allows the new scenarios of health, cultural, social and economic crisis resulting from the Covid-19 pandemic to be faced.
